Types of support available
In Solvay, individuals facing domestic violence can access a range of support options:
- Lawyers: Legal professionals who specialize in domestic violence cases can help you understand your rights and navigate the legal system.
- Therapists: Mental health professionals provide counseling and support to help you process your experiences and work towards healing.
- Shelters: Safe havens for individuals escaping abusive situations, offering temporary housing and resources.
- Hotlines: Confidential support services available 24/7, providing immediate assistance and guidance.
- Legal Aid: Organizations that offer free or low-cost legal assistance to those who qualify, ensuring access to necessary legal support.

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is an important step in protecting yourself. Consider the following basics when developing your plan:
- Identify safe places you can go in an emergency.
- Have a packed bag ready with essentials, including important documents.
- Establish a code word with friends or family to alert them when you need help.
- Keep a charged phone with emergency contacts saved.
